About the Author

Jean-Marie Gustave Le Clézio (born 1940) is a French novelist of French, Mauritian, and British nationality, renowned for over forty works exploring humanity beyond modern civilization, including notable novels Le Procès-Verbal (1963) and Désert (1980). He received the Prix Renaudot in 1963 and the Nobel Prize in Literature in 2008 for his poetic adventure and sensual ecstasy in writing.
